Does Lloyd Banks Just Announce His Retirement From Rap? ‘I Think It’s Time to Lay It Down’

As we all know, the things are the members of G-Unit have been having their own issues among one another that made headlines for a while. 50 Cent even recently said on record that he wasn’t really talking to Lloyd Banks anymore.

Does Lloyd Banks Just Announce His Retirement From Rap?

The two artists have been clashing over multiple issues over the past few years, that drew lots of attention and generated so much buzz, but now it seems like hopes of the two ever reuniting on a track have been squashed.

Lloyd took to Twitter and shared some news with her followers, he expressed his longtime love for hip-hop, followed by an announcement that he thinks it was time to “lay it down.” The self-proclaimed Punchline King also thanked the artists who came before him and all those who continue to love and support him.

The rapper tweeted, “I fell in love with Hip Hop over 25 years ago.” He wrote, “It was that thing I turned to during good times and bad… just wanna say thank you to the artist B4 me that inspired me… and send my appreciation to everyone that supported me till this day THANK YOU!!”

 

The rapper quickly followed up the tweet with a little more forward, saying, “With that being said… I think it’s time to lay it down.”

 

However, Lloyd hasn’t specified in his tweets about what he meant since then, which leading fans to believe that the rapper announcing his possible retirement. The curious fans are sharing their theories on Lloyd’s tweets. No comments from the rapper and his representative have been made yet.

Lloyd’s tweets quickly drew attention from fans, responding it the rapper was joking and whether his announcement would be followed by the release of the latest mixtape or if he was really retiring from his hip-hop career.

One fan wrote, “it’s too early for a April fools joke.” Another added, “I hope you mean lay it down in the booth been patiently waiting for more.”

One user wrote, “Lay it down as in your about to announce your next project??”

Lloyd gained popularity as a member of G-Unit, alongside Tony Yayo and 50 Cent.
